Key Weather Monitoring Devices

Meteorologists rely on precision instruments to measure atmospheric conditions. These devices form the backbone of weather prediction systems worldwide.

Temperature Measurement Tools

Thermometers remain fundamental for measuring air temperature. Modern digital versions provide real-time data logging capabilities.

Atmospheric Pressure Sensors

Barometers track pressure changes, crucial for predicting short-term weather shifts. Mercury and aneroid variants serve different applications.

Advanced Meteorological Systems

Contemporary weather stations integrate multiple sensors for comprehensive data collection. These systems automatically transmit measurements to central databases.

Frequently Asked Questions

What instrument measures wind speed?

Anemometers quantify wind velocity using rotating cups or ultrasonic sensors.

How do hygrometers work?

These devices measure humidity through capacitive or resistive sensing elements.
